Polkner Cracks Top 50 as Men’s Cross Country Takes 10th at MEC Championships

Wheeling, W. Va. – The 2025 Mountain East Conference (MEC) Men's Cross Country Championships rolled on Saturday from Oglebay Park with the men's 8K following the women. The Wheeling University Men's Cross Country team what take the field with three of their five runners competing at the event for the first time in their careers. In the end, the Cardinals would finish 10th in the field as they began their post-season run.

Leading the way for the fourth race in a row was sophomore Magnus Polkner, who was the lone Cardinal to crack the top 50 of the event. He would finish in that 42nd position with a time of 28:34.97, As he set a new personal best for placing at the event. He would shade eight seconds on his championship time from a season ago, while jumping 17 spots in the individual results. Polkner has been a leader for the Cardinals ever since training the team. The Bethany Invitational taking his runs to new heights. He was just 14 seconds shy of cracking the top 40 in the event as he continues to improve his game on the cross country course. He set PR's In two of the four races that he ran this year and will be looking for one more as he heads to the regional Championship.

Hunter Tomich would compete at the event for the final time in his career and ended things strong, finishing in the top 65. Tomich would put up a time of 29:52.37. Tomich would finishh three seconds behind West Liberty's Lorimer Finlay, and looks to continue his success onto the regional stage. The next two runners for the Cardinals finish neck and neck us Tyler Crook and Courtney Rider took 84th and 85th respectively. It was Crook I was able to just beat out Rider, setting a PR for the championship course with a time of 32:59.88  It was the fastest he had ever run at the event highest place he ever had as he started his Post season run. Rider was writing the course for the first time in his career and finished just behind him with a time of 33:03.09. The two had been battling for position all season long and helped each other throughout the race.

The final two Cardinal runners were Aidan McKenna and Chris Vigars closing out the six Cardinal runners. McKenna would be the first one home finishing 87th st 35:04.40. He rounded out the team portion of the event, rounding out a strong freshman campaign. Vigars would finish out the effort, taking 90th at 39:04.72.

The Wheeling University Men's Cross Country team returns to action on Saturday, November 8th, when they take on the 2025 NCAA DII Atlantic Regional Championships.
